Time of Update: 2015-09-20
標籤:情境:剛接觸redis;想著redis各方面API做一些嘗試;然後遇到了一些困惑的事情;第一登入的時候並不要求輸入密碼;找了下資料;修改了設定檔;發現重新啟動的時候並不管用;依舊可以串連;並且執行命令; 解決: 231081694(linux營運之家)-> 深圳丶浪人(361***917) 給了我一個建議;是不是正確的載入了設定檔; 然後我把設定檔重新命名了一下;重新啟動;重連;發現依舊可以登入;並且執行命令;
Time of Update: 2015-09-22
標籤:redis redis_windwos安裝 windowssession問題 kv-redis windwos2008搭建redis redis windows下的環境搭建 Redis是一個key-value儲存系統。和Memcached類似,
Time of Update: 2015-09-23
標籤:Redis安裝: Windows安裝包:http://pan.baidu.com/s/1i3jLlC5 下載下來之後,開始安裝: Redis-server.exe redis.conf: 簡單一步,安裝成功,保持這個Windows持續運行~ 查看一下我們原生連接埠,可以看到多了一個6379連接埠,安全風險來了,記得設定redis的密碼~ 接下來,開始利用redis-cli.exe來進行遠程redis的入侵:
Time of Update: 2015-09-23
標籤:redis的KEY的基本操作:keys TEST*del TEST_STRINGstring類型操作方法:set TEST_STRING abcget
Time of Update: 2015-09-23
標籤:# By default Redis does not run as a daemon. Use ‘yes‘ if you need it.# Note that Redis will write a pid file in /var/run/redis.pid when
Time of Update: 2015-09-23
標籤:目錄1、Replication的工作原理2、如何配置Redis主從複製3、應用樣本1、Replication的工作原理在Slave啟動並串連到Master之後,它將主動發送一條SYNC命令。此後Master將啟動後台存檔進程,同時收集所有接收到的用於修改資料集的命令,在後台進程執行完畢後,Master將傳送整個資料庫檔案到Slave,以完成一次完全同步。而Slave伺服器在接收到資料庫檔案資料之後將其存檔並載入到記憶體中。此後,Master繼續將所有已經收集到的修改命令,和新的修改命令依次
Time of Update: 2015-09-22
標籤:參考資料 linux 虛擬機器 訪問量 用戶端 網站的訪問量慢慢上來了。為了網站的效能方面,開始用了redis做緩衝策略。剛開始的時候,redis是一個單點,當一台機器岩機的時候,redis的 服務完全停止,這時就會影響其他服務的正常運行。費話不多說了,下面利用redis
Time of Update: 2015-09-22
標籤:nginx-tomcat-redis(session共用)tomcat-session-redis配置Session持久機制三種實現方法:1、session綁定:始終將來自同一個源IP的請求定向至同一個RS;沒有容錯能力;有損均衡效果(sh)2、session複製:在RS之間同步session,每個RS擁有叢集中的所有的session;對規模叢集不適用;必須RS支援(lblcr)3、session伺服器:利用單獨部署的伺服器來統一管理叢集中的session;(單有單點故障)nginx-to
Time of Update: 2015-09-21
標籤:rediswindows: https://github.com/MSOpenTech/redis/releases12645:M 29 Jul 23:05:55.764 # Server started, Redis version 3.0.312645:M 29 Jul 23:05:55.766 # WARNING overcommit_memory is set to 0! Background save may fail under low memory condition.
Time of Update: 2015-09-21
標籤:sub codis 到期事件 pub 1. Redis處理到期事件方式1.1. Redis處理到期key方式Redis key到期的方式有二:被動方式和主動方式當clients試圖訪問設定了到期時間且已到期的key時,為主動到期方式。但僅是這樣是不夠的,以為可能存在一些key永遠不會被再次訪問到,
Time of Update: 2015-09-21
標籤:環境資訊: CentOS 6.5 redis 3.0.4 logstash elasticsearch kibana 服務端ip:192.168.0.65 用戶端ip:192.168.0.66 關係結構圖: 圖片引用自:http://www.wklken.me/posts/2015/04/26/elk-for-nginx-log.html 安裝redis 首先下載redis wget
Time of Update: 2015-09-21
標籤:redis是個對記憶體依賴性很強的NoSql資料庫,在記憶體足夠的情況下效能出色如果只有一台機子去部署redis,一定要特別小心。比如我有台24G的伺服器,理所當然我會將大量記憶體配置給redis。比如20G的記憶體, 問題來了, 當你對redis插入資料後,redis會非同步將資料dump到硬碟中想起來很完美,問題是它會fork一個進程,並佔去同樣大小的記憶體,你需要的記憶體瞬間便為 20G+20G
Time of Update: 2015-09-21
標籤:由於項目中需要使用批量插入功能, 所以在網上尋找到了Redis 批量插入可以使用pipeline來高效的插入, 範例程式碼如下: String key = "key";Jedis jedis = new Jedis("xx.xx.xx.xx");Pipeline p = jedis.pipelined();List<String> myData = .... //要插入的資料列表for(String data: myData){ p.hset(key,
Time of Update: 2015-09-21
標籤:回到目錄這個文章其實是我心中的核心組件的第七回,確實在時間上有些滯後了,但內容並不滯後!本文MSMQ只是個引題,我確實不太想說它,它是微軟自己整合的一套訊息佇列,寄宿在Window服務裡,穩定性十在不敢恭維,而redis隊列我們選擇的驅動用戶端是ServiceStack.Redis,之所以選擇它就是因為它穩定,更新快,對於其它的驅動可能用上幾年都不會去更新,而ServiceStack.Redis一直走到redis用戶端的前沿!Redis隊列即時和非即時:這個說的即時和非即時主要針對的是消費
Time of Update: 2015-09-20
標籤:1.賦值、取值、刪除(字串類型) set key value get key del key2.遞增數字 incr key incrby key increment incrby 與incr命令基本一樣,incrby可通過increment指定每次增加的數值。3.減少指定的整數
Time of Update: 2015-09-20
標籤:在Mybatis中允許開發人員自訂自己的緩衝,本文將使用Redis作為Mybatis的二級緩衝。在Mybatis中定義二級緩衝,需要如下配置:1、 MyBatis支援二級緩衝的總開關:全域組態變數參數“cacheEnabled=true”2、select語句所在的Mapper需配置了<cache> 或<cached-ref>節點3、select語句的參數 useCache=trueMybatis設定檔如下:<settings&
Time of Update: 2015-09-19
標籤:redis sentinel
Time of Update: 2015-09-19
標籤:一.安全性設定密碼:在設定檔中設定requirepass 123456由於redis的速度非常快,每秒可以進行15萬次的暴力破解,所以密碼設定要強壯些在用戶端登入或者串連的時候,使用 auth 123456進行授權,以後才有許可權繼續也可以在登入的時候直接指定,例如 /usr/local/redis/bin/redis-cli -a 123456 二,主從複製修改從伺服器的配置開啟 slaveof 前的#注釋,設定 slaveof 主伺服器IP
Time of Update: 2015-09-18
標籤:redis3.0叢集親測jedis(jedis2.7.2)用戶端 JedisCluster 可用1:安裝redis cluster 以及依賴
Time of Update: 2015-09-18
標籤:1、安裝,啟動 redis 0> yum install redis0> /etc/init.d/redis start0> netstat -antlp | grep redistcp 0 0 127